WebSpent brewer’s yeast, the second major by- product from brewing industry, is the yeast which remains after the brewing process. It is a fermented product containing inactive yeast cells and metabolites formed during fermentation. Disposal of this major byproduct is a problem for the breweries. This process was demonstrated on a laboratory scale using a litre of material and on a pilot scale of 30 litres. WebIn general, this strain of yeast foams a lot and isn't super easy to harvest. The best method (in our brewery), is to crash to 5 degrees C (sorry, Canadian) after a VDK rest, harvest 24 hrs after crash, dry hop at 5C 24 hours after harvest. We haven't noticed a drop in aromatics or quality by dry hopping cold. head of steam leeds mill hill
